Frommer's Review
Orchids highlights fresh local produce and seafood with elegant presentations in a fantasy setting with consummate service. Blinding white linens and a view of Diamond Head from the open oceanfront dining room will start you off with a smile. (The parade of oiled bodies traversing the seawall is part of the entertainment.) At lunch, the seafood and vegetable curries, though pricey, are winners, and the steamed ehu (short-tail red snapper) is an Orchids signature. The executive lunch specials are an excellent way to sample this fare without breaking the bank: $22 for two courses and $26 for three. For dinner, onaga is steamed with ginger, Chinese parsley, shiitake mushrooms, and soy sauce, then drizzled with hot sesame oil -- delightful. Delicately textured opakapaka is sautéed and presented with wasabi mashed potatoes and wasabi cream, another pleaser with Asian undertones. Lamb, chicken, and beef entrees are offered as well, and the desserts, especially the chocolate hazelnut dacquoise and the Halekulani signature coconut cake, are extraordinary. Sunday brunch, with its outstanding selection of dishes, is one of the best in Hawaii.
